east central ND | A number of years ago the companies were short on seed for my area, got most of what we ordered, but all the brands must have opened up the cleaning and sizing machines a bit. We had an old plate planter at the time, and always ordered medium flats as they fed through and singulated fairly well...... The bags of seed had flats, rounds, all sorts of sizes. No help from dealers, they said that's all they had available. Fed through the planter terrible. Got a vacume planter the next year, and have yet to see that kind of mess in a seed bag since. | |
